Consistency and Quality

People often equate frequent, consistent publishing with trustworthiness. Automated blogging can meet this expectation by ensuring a steady flow of content, thereby reinforcing a brand's presence in the digital sphere. However, it is crucial that the quality of the automated content does not suffer, as low-quality or irrelevant posts can detrimentally affect how a brand is viewed. Therefore, content customization plays a vital role in maintaining content that resonates well with the target audience.

Challenges and Considerations

Despite the clear benefits, automated blogging does pose some risks to brand perception. The depersonalization of content is a potential pitfall. Audiences appreciate authentic, personalized engagement, which can be difficult to achieve through automated processes that rely heavily on algorithms and devoid of human touch.

Personal Touch vs. Automation: To counterbalance this, brands might consider employing a hybrid approach, blending automated tools with human oversight. This ensures that the content remains genuine and aligned with the brand's voice while also leveraging the efficiency of automation. A customizable content tone can significantly mitigate the impersonal nature of automation by allowing brands to infuse their unique voice into Ai-generated content.

Real-World Implications and Examples

To understand the tangible effects of automated blogging on brand perception, examining real-world examples can be enlightening. Consider a tech startup using AI to automate its blog post creation. The company reports an increase in digital marketing ROI due to consistent SEO-focused content delivery. However, feedback also suggests that while efficiency improved, the content's emotional impact was not as pronounced as when crafted by a skilled human writer.

To address this, the company revisited its strategy to include more human elements in critical pieces, such as thought leadership articles, while leaving routine updates to automated systems. This blend ensured the company capitalized on AI's strengths without losing its human ethos.
